Arnett's Five Features
Key characteristics defining emerging adulthood, including identity exploration, instability, self-focus, feeling in-between, and possibilities/optimism for the future.
Adolescent Development
The physical, emotional, psychological, and social changes that occur during the transition from childhood to adulthood.
